Cam Topdrew Bottom Posted December 28, 2012 Share Posted December 28, 2012 Y'ALL SERIOUSLE NEED TO GET PAST THIS EIFERT MAN CRUSH.Dude is a top 15 pick and will not slide.As your GM I will give you all one last chance to get busy scoutingor I will find somebody that will.Now being that picks 28-32 are nothing more than Top Tier 2nd round pickswe best get busy on the players that present the Best Overall value.Here you can land a Blue Chip OG, and we want massive road grader withgood feet for pass protection.The Premier D Line 3-4 and 4-3 will already be gone.You all say that you are tired of drafting O Line, butBytch after the game that Ryan has no pass protection.Well By Gawd! we are going to fix that with our first and 4th picksUnless a dynamic RB somehow slips through the cracks.I am not your Dime a Dozen Message Board GM.I am the Message Board GM that has 2 plastic wraped rolls of quarters.So Either get busy being real or it is Me vs all of you at the Waffle HouseWhy is Eifert a top 15 lock? He isn't the physical freak that is going to blow up the combine plus he doesn't have filthy stats. He is a nice TE prospect but far from a top 15 lock. Who are the last TEs to go in the top 15? Winslos Jr. and Davis but that was because they were freak athletes and Eifert is not. Without that freak athleticism it is really hard to say he will be a top 15 lock as a TE. Cam Topdrew Bottom Posted December 28, 2012 Share Posted December 28, 2012 (edited) TE has evolved in the NFL.The #1 TE in the draft will not slide no matter what.Bradford is struggling with the Rams and they are not getting any noteableproduction from their TE's.Eifert is gone ny #15 and a slide would see him off the boards before 20.So If as you say he is not a Freak then why would we trade up for this guywhen we already have Chase Coffman?Protecting Ryan is the #1 Priority this year unless a DLineman slides down.I never said trade up for him but if he is there at the back half of round 1, which isn't all that unlikely, I would love the pick.The TE position hasn't evolved all that much aside from Gronk being freakishly good. Before Gronk we had guys like Witten, Gates and Gonzo plus lesser guys putting up 700-1000 yards a season which is what the better pass catching TEs are doing now. Outside of Gronk/Graham busting the TE records last year and become in vogue for a while not much else has really changed and no teams were running out to spend top 15 picks on TEs.Lots of guys with similar pedigree and athleticism to Eifert have gone late round 1. Guys like Zach Miller, Dustin Keller, and Greg Olsen. Even ND products Carlson and Rudolph who had similar size speed and production to Eifert went early 2nd.I can certainly see Eifert going earlier but I just don't think it is a lock.
